K.'.'PVC CROSS W Z COUPLER(3Y INSTALLER, L I"CCUPL ER(BY INSTALLER) vryf Revised 2/25/12 VC56— 1 Clueut Septic Deatgrta �e NuWater BNR Pretreatment ttek i • it INSTALLATION &MAINTENANCE .,.s' . . .4.4 Pressure Distribution Systems :. .• .. SGc24 y j ,PAULAAc��JOY JOHNSON roFISR5ga ION 1. Install Laterals with contour of the ground. OtP azs 2. Install trench bottoms level. 3. Install locator tape or rebar at each end of all drainfield laterals. 4. Install observation ports as indicated on the plot plan. One required at distal end of each lateral in drainfield with bottom extending to the drainrock/native soil interface. Glue "T"to bottom so Observation Port cannot be easily removed from ground. Install removable cap on top of port at final grade level. 5. Install drainfield during dry weather and soil conditions; any soil smearing must be eliminated by hand raking. 6. Install threaded clean-outs at the end of all laterals (cap must extend to within six inches of finished grade and be marked with locator tape or rebar). 7. Install audio/visual high water level alarm. Redundant off switch not required. 8. Install check valve in pump outlet line to prevent system from draining back into the pump chamber. 9. Tee to Tee construction between laterals and manifold with orifices oriented at 6 o'clock. Install laterals to the manifold with the orifices at 12 o'clock, (do not glue), after pressure test and Environmental Health Dept. approval,turn orifices down(6 o'clock)and glue laterals to manifold. Orifice shields may be used with orifices in the 12 o'clock position in lieu of turning the orifices down to the 6 o'clock position. 10. Filter fabric required over drain rock prior to back filling. If the drain rock extends above natural grade, run the filter fabric at least 2 inches down the trench wall. 11. Encase all water lines within 10' of drainfield and under any driveway/parking areas. 12. Divert all storm water runoff away from on-site sewage system. 13.No curtain drains allowed within 10' of the up-slope edge or 30' of the down-slope edge of the drainfield and reserve area. 14.No vehicular traffic over drainfield area. 15. Inspect floats, clean filters, and test high water level alarm every 6-12 months as needed. 16.All materials and workmanship must meet County and State regulations. 17. Deviation from this design without prior approval from the Designer and Mason County Environmental Health Department will make this design null and void. 18. All manhole lids and access, sampling or inspection ports must have locking covers and be located at ground level. 19. All pressure systems with a pump chamber outlet higher than the drainfield must have a 1/8"hole drilled in the discharge pipe above the pump to prevent siphoning. 20. All transport lines under driveways or parking areas must be encased to prevent crushing. 21. Homeowner is responsible for all property lines. 22. Please Note: When you begin using your septic system, contact your septic installer to discuss setting up a schedule for your required Operation&Maintenance on your NuWater pretreatment system.
